MONTREAL, March 30, 2022 /CNW/ - Prana, a leader within the organic and plant-based food industry, is pleased to announce the signing of a three-year credit agreement for a senior secured revolving loan facility and a senior secured term loan facility with Wells Fargo Capital Finance Corporation Canada that will enable the next stage of the company’s growth.

“This facility provides Prana with the access to the working capital we need to execute our strategic plan. We see great opportunities in our markets and are eager to expand our offering and provide better food solutions to consumers,” said Alon Farber, Prana’s co-founder and CEO. 

“Health and wellness remain top of mind in our current environment, so Wells Fargo is excited to support a family-owned business like Prana, whose priority is bringing sustainable, responsibly sourced food to consumers,” said Jeremy Baker, managing director for the Central U.S. and Canada loan origination group with Wells Fargo Capital Finance. “We look forward to helping Prana execute on their ambitious growth plans and we’re pleased to be part of their continued journey.”

About Prana 

A Montreal-based certified B Corp https://bcorporation.net/about-b-corps) Prana is a leading manufacturer and marketer of organic snacks and plant-based foods. Founded in 2005 by husband and wife team Alon Farber and Marie-Josee Richer, Prana is Canada’s leading brand in organic nuts, trail mix, seeds and dried fruits, and has recently expanded its portfolio into value-added snacks including chocolate and breakfast (granola, overnight chia). The Prana brand can be purchased in over 4,000 points of sale across Canada and in the U.S. A progressive and values-driven organisation of 100 employees, Prana is committed to a “Triple P” bottom-line (Profit, People and Planet).

About Wells Fargo 

Wells Fargo & Company (NYSE: WFC) is a leading financial services company that has approximately $1.9 trillion in assets, proudly serves one in three U.S. households and more than 10% of small businesses in the U.S., and is the leading middle market banking provider in the U.S. We provide a diversified set of banking, investment and mortgage products and services, as well as consumer and commercial finance, through our four reportable operating segments: Consumer Banking and Lending, Commercial Banking, Corporate and Investment Banking, and Wealth & Investment Management. Wells Fargo ranked No. 37 on Fortune’s 2021 rankings of America’s largest corporations. In the communities we serve, the company focuses its social impact on building a sustainable, inclusive future for all by supporting housing affordability, small business growth, financial health, and a low-carbon economy.
